ABSTRACT:
In one embodiment, an antenna array is provided that includes a transparent substrate, a plurality of antennas formed on a surface of the transparent substrate, and an integrated circuit, the integrated circuit including an RF beam forming interface circuit adapted to perform at least one of phase-shifting and attenuating an RF signal according to a transmit beam forming command to form an RF driving signal for driving the plurality of antennas, the RF beam forming interface circuit also adapted to perform at least one of phase-shifting and attenuating a received RF signal from the plurality of antennas according to a receive beam forming command.
